Erica Moser, The RMH Group Erica Moser is a licensed mechanical engineer and Vice President at The RMH Group, where she leads the Science and Technology market sector. With over 15 years of experience, Erica has demonstrated exceptional leadership in managing complex engineering projects and mentoring high-performing teams. She holds PE licenses in six states and has a proven track record of delivering technical excellence and operational efficiency.
Erica’s commitment to professional development and organizational leadership is evident through her long-standing involvement with DBIA and ASHRAE. She currently serves as the Rocky Mountain DBIA Vertical Member Committee Engagement Chair and has held multiple leadership roles within ASHRAE, including Chapter President. Erica is highly organized, detail-oriented, and experienced in maintaining governance documentation, coordinating communications, and supporting strategic initiatives—skills directly aligned with the DBIA Secretary role.
Beyond her professional achievements, Erica is deeply committed to community service and champions initiatives that promote inclusion, education, and innovation. Her dedication to excellence, integrity, and collaboration makes her a strong candidate for Secretary of the DBIA Rocky Mountain Region Executive Board.
Heather Green, Swinerton Starting her career with Hensel Phelps in California, Heather had the opportunity to work on multiple large-scale Design-Build projects. Right out of college , she was able to be an estimator and a field engineer on a $200M Design-Build laboratory that sparked her interest and excitement for the procurement method. She loved having the freedom to work with the architect and solve problems together with the Design team as well as Design-Build Subcontractors. She has worked on several Design-Build projects in Colorado since then. She is a strong advocate for increasing Design-Build in Colorado, as well as helping educate owners and architects on its potential as a successful procurement method.
Gary Shironaka, Growling Bear Co Gary Shironaka brings more than 31 years of leadership in design-build experience to his candidacy for Treasurer of the DBIA Rocky Mountain Region. As President of Growling Bear Co. Inc., he has stewarded the firm’s overall fiscal health, overseeing annual budgeting, cash-flow projections, and adherence to rigorous accounting standards. Under his direction, the company implemented enhanced cost-control systems, improved forecasting accuracy, and strengthened internal audit processes, resulting in consistently reliable financial reporting and transparency for shareholders.

As a certified MBE/DBE/SBE firm owner, Gary integrates inclusive practices into every aspect of business, ensuring equitable subcontractor engagement and supporting diverse participation goals. His expertise in risk analysis and reserve planning has strengthened organizational resilience against market fluctuations, while his collaborative leadership style promotes cross-functional alignment among estimating, operations, and executive teams.

Gary holds a Bachelor of Science in Construction Management and actively participates in regional industry and professional associations. His record of ethical stewardship, strategic resource allocation, and commitment to continuous improvement positions him to excel in supporting the Rocky Mountain Region’s mission of advancing design-build excellence.
